Audrey Johnson of Middletown, NJ passed away on Jan. 28, 2018. She was predeceased by loving husband, William C. Johnson, Jr. and devoted son Lars Wikman, stepsons Kirk Johnson and William C. Johnson III, and sister, Shirley Kluin. She is survived by sisters Dottie Ralph, Beverly French, Pat Newman, brother Fred Brink, and her children Lisa Woodfield, A. Christopher Wikman and wife Jane, Eric Corser Wikman and wife Jennifer, daughter-in-law, Julie Wikman, step daughter-in-law, Kathy Johnson, stepson, Chris Johnson. Audrey adored her grandchildren, Bill, Grete, Emily, Andrew, Max, Sarah, David, Sean, Will, and Colin and seven great- grandchildren.

Audrey was a lifelong resident of Monmouth County where she was married and raised her four children. A natural Scandinavian-heritage beauty, she appeared on the cover of Life magazine when in her teens. Audrey was a graduate of Red Bank High School, a member of Navesink Country Club, and an avid gardener and bird enthusiast. She enjoyed playing golf (scoring a hole-in-one in 2000), playing mahjong, and spending time with her friends, some of whom she had known for 70 years. Audrey spent her life putting others before herself along with being known for her kind and generous spirit.

Visitation will be at the Thompson Memorial Home, 310 Broad St, Red Bank on Thursday, Feb 1st from 4 to 7 PM.  There will be a funeral service on Friday at 10 AM at the funeral home.  In lieu of flowers donations may be made in her name to the National Audubon Society.
